MySQL注释指南:三种注释方法及解析细节
创始人
2024-12-27 23:07:22
0 次浏览
0 评论
MySQL的注释
MySQL注释MySQL服务器支持三种注释样式:
·从行尾开始使用“#”字符。
·从“--”序列到行尾。
请注意,“--”(双连字符)注释样式要求第二个连字符后至少跟一个空格(例如空格、制表符、换行符等)。
此语法与1.8.5.7“'--'作为注释开始标记”中讨论的标准SQL注释语法略有不同。
·从/序列到下面的/序列。
结束序列不一定位于同一行,因此使用此语法的注释可以跨越多行。
下面的例子显示了三种注释样式:
SELECT1+1;#Thiscommentcontinuetotheendoflinemysql>SELECT1+1;--Thiscommentcontinuetotheendoflinemysql>SELECT1/*thisisanin-linecomment/+1;mysql>SELECT1+/thisisa多行注释*/1;以上注释语法适用于MySQLD服务器如何解析SQL语句。在发送到服务器之前,MySQL客户端程序还会对语句进行部分解析。
(例如,它执行分析以确定多语句行上的语句边界。
)
在MySQL5.1中,MySQL解析/*...*/注释的唯一限制是:使用感叹号与这种类型的注释分隔符一起标记SQL语句的条件执行部分。
适合交互式运行MySQL并向文件中插入命令,以及以批处理模式使用MySQL处理MySQL
关于MySQL中SQL注释的详细介绍mysql中sql注释
MySQL中的SQL注释详细介绍MySQL中的SQL注释是一种为SQL语句添加注释的方法,它可以帮助开发人员更好地理解SQL语句的含义和作用,方便大型数据库系统的维护。本文将详细介绍MySQL中SQL注释的语法、类型和使用场景。
语法在MySQL中,SQL注释分为两种类型:单行注释和多行注释。
单行注释用“-”注释,多行注释用“/**/”注释。
以下是注释的语法示例:1.单行注释SELECT*FROMtable_nameWHEREcolumn_name='value'—这是单行注释2。
多行注释/*Thisisamulti-linecommentline2line3*/类型MySQL中的SQL注释主要有三种类型:解释性注释、临时注释和调试注释。
1、解释性注释:这类注释主要用于向其他维护人员或系统管理员解释SQL语句的含义或功能。
例如:/*此查询从用户表中选择所有用户*/2。
临时注释:该注释类型主要用于临时调整SQL语句的执行方式。
例如,您可以在开发和测试环境中使用此注释类型,而在生产环境中您应该删除所有临时注释。
例如:SELECT/*SQL_NO_CACHE*/*FROMusers3、调试注释:该注释类型主要用于调试SQL语句。
通过在SQL语句中添加调试注释,可以帮助您提高SQL语句的性能,方便排查问题。
可以输出与执行相关的信息。
例如:SELECT*FROMusers/*debug*/;使用场景MySQL中的SQL注释主要用于以下场景:1.解释SQL语句的功能和含义,以便其他开发人员或系统管理员更好地理解。
2、在开发和测试环境中,使用临时注释来调整SQL语句的执行,以更好地测试SQL语句的性能和正确性。
3、排查问题时,利用调试注释输出SQL语句执行的相关信息,以便更好地定位和解决问题。
总结MySQL中的SQL注释是一个强大的工具,可以帮助开发人员更好地理解SQL语句的含义和作用,方便大型数据库系统的维护。
在使用SQL注释时,需要注意注释的类型和使用场景,以便更好地发挥注释的作用。
相关文章
C语言复数表示与输出技巧解析
2024-12-21 22:49:12C语言正则匹配与字符串查找技巧分享
2024-12-26 06:12:29C语言字符串大小比较教程:字符级详解
2025-01-06 00:46:37C语言数字转字符串:itoa()函数详解...
2024-12-18 12:31:02C语言编程挑战:奇偶数判断与工资计算及字...
2025-01-09 23:59:37C语言实现字符串数组倒序输出教程
2024-12-18 05:38:24Docker终端命令全解析:镜像、容器管...
2024-12-16 17:54:31C语言实现:如何找出N个字符串中的最大串...
2024-12-16 07:56:27计算机二级C语言考试:改错题found能...
2024-12-16 12:53:58Oracle日期差计算技巧:等效SQL ...
2025-01-09 09:34:09最新文章
13
2025-01
13
2025-01
13
2025-01
13
2025-01
13
2025-01
13
2025-01
13
2025-01
13
2025-01
13
2025-01
13
2025-01
热门文章
1
Redisson分布式锁深度解析:Red...
Redis实现分布式锁+Redisson源码解析在某些场景下,多个进程需要以互斥...
2
深度解析Docker:容器技术提升应用部...
docker是什么Docker是一种强大的开源容器技术,它将应用程序及其所有依赖...
3
C语言实现:如何判断一个整数是否为质数?
C语言输入一个整数,判断是否是质数?#include//头文件intmain()...
4
K8s弃用Docker背后的故事及Doc...
K8s为什么要弃用Docker?在讨论K8s抛弃Docker的话题时,我们首先需...
5
C语言文本输入输出教程:安全高效处理字符...
C语言怎么变成文字?如果你想用C语言输入输出文本,其实很简单。您必须首先定义一个...
6
深入解析Java:面向对象编程特性与实现...
Java语言的特点,实现机制和体系结构。中的任何实体都可以被视为一个对象。对象通...
7
三款免费Docker管理工具,提升您的可...
3款免费又好用的Docker可视化管理工具在Docker的世界里,命令行工具无疑...
8
C语言期末编程题解析:完整程序代码分享
C语言期末考试编程代码函数题?按照题目要求编写的完整程序如下(见图,图中重复的部...
9
轻松掌握:Redis键值查看技巧,两种方...
如何读取redis中的key值中的结果我们希望它能帮助您使用它。怎么查看redi...
10
SQL DELETE语句:详解及不同删除...
请问Sql的DELETE语句怎么写delete表示删除表中的数据示例:delet...